What difference can ten minutes make? In this episode of Sutton United Talk Time on Podcast, Nick joins from Los Angeles to reflect on Sutton United’s latest draw — a game where late drama, missed chances, and sheer persistence left us thinking we could have nicked it with just a little more time.


We cover:


The atmosphere in LA as a Sutton fan (and explaining the club to curious Americans)


Team selection, tactics, and the return to 4-4-2


That dramatic late goal: cross, shot, or a bit of both?


Confidence, finishing, and why belief matters more than ever


Managerial change and speculation on what’s next


Notable Quote:


“If it had gone on for another ten minutes, we would’ve won it.” — Nick


Nick’s unique perspective from across the pond adds humour and passion to a wide-ranging chat about Sutton United’s momentum.
